Pezeshkian calls on BRICS to strengthen defense of national sovereignty, oppose force
Tehran - BORNA - Addressing the 18th BRICS Plus Summit in New Delhi under the theme "Resilience, Cooperation and Sustainability: Shaping the Future for Inclusive Global Growth," the Iranian president stressed that no single nation can address contemporary global challenges in isolation.

Resilience means possessing the necessary capacity to maintain the path of development and independence in decision-making, even under pressure. Over-reliance on limited financial and commercial systems leaves economies vulnerable to political shocks. Today, unilateral sanctions are not merely an economic issue; they directly impact food security and public welfare. Therefore, BRICS must build a collective capacity for the economic resilience of its members by expanding trade in national currencies and strengthening the New Development Bank.
Economic resilience will not be sustainable without security. The developments in our region, particularly the military aggression by the United States and the Zionist regime against the Islamic Republic of Iran, have demonstrated that the impacts of targeting a country's economic, energy, and developmental infrastructure rapidly transcend its borders, resulting in regional and global consequences.
The Iranian people have paid a heavy price for these aggressions. Men, women, children, and civilians have lost their lives, and the infrastructure built over decades for the country's development has been damaged. These events serve as a stark reminder of the international community's heavy responsibility to protect civilians and prevent the normalization of attacks on civilian targets.
The people of Gaza and Lebanon also continue to face the consequences of atrocities and genocide. One cannot speak of international law if there is no effective international response to military aggression, the slaughter of human beings, and the destruction of their lives. Hence, BRICS must play a more effective role in defending national sovereignty, territorial integrity, and the prohibition of the use of force.

The second pillar is 'Cooperation.' No single country can resolve today's global challenges alone. BRICS must transform the dispersed capacities of the Global South into a unified capability. In this context, the geopolitical position, energy resources, and transit capacity of the Islamic Republic of Iran can play an effective role in developing trade and energy routes among member states.
The third pillar is 'Sustainability.' Development that exacerbates inequality or shifts today's costs onto the shoulders of future generations will not be sustainable. We must not forget that war is one of the most severe drivers of environmental destruction. Iran's recent experience has shown that damage to energy and industrial infrastructure carries consequences far beyond economic losses, severely affecting the region's natural resources.
Alongside these three pillars, 'Knowledge and Innovation' is also a determining factor. BRICS must ensure that artificial intelligence and emerging technologies do not become instruments of hegemony, but rather tools for the empowerment of nations.
